Comparison of Digestion Methods for the Determination of Total Mercury in Environmental Samples by Flow Injection CV-AAS

摘要

Three closed digestion methods were evaluated for the fast, accurate and precise determination of total mercury in environmental samples by flow injection cold vapor atomic absorption specirometry. The method based on the use of HNO_3-H_2O_2 mixture with microwave oven pre-treatmenl was found to be the most suitable for reliable determination of mercury. The methods based on the use of HNO_3 for digestion gave incomplete recovery of methyl mercury and the determinations were strongly interfered withby the volatile nitrogen oxides. This interference was not observed with the HNO_3-H_2O_2 digestion mixture. The application of the best method to mercury deposition study provided accurate and reproducible analytical data.
